Watching The Time Go Past



Every year, I say to myself, time is
moving so fast! In fact, it's rather
scary, watching as the time goes
past! I thought it only happened as
one grew older, but that's not true
anymore. For young or old, it doesn't
matter, they too, are keeping score!
I can remember, when I used to say,
'I wish this day, was over, ' I couldn't
wait, for it to end. Now, before I even
think it, it's gone, another day, is
waiting around the bend! It's hard
keeping up with the times, it's
changing rapidly! Just when I think
I've caught up, something new, is put
in front of me. No use to fret, or even
bother, to get upset, I'll learn, whatever
is new. Then hopefully, in time and lots
of patience, somehow I'll manage, to
get through!
